Schwarzenegger Tells Assemblyman "F**k You" in Cryptic Letter




Arnold Schwarzenegger, the hubristic Governator of California, appears to have a puerile streak in him because it has been discovered that he sent San Francisco Assemblyman Tom Ammiano a letter in which a profanity was expressed in a cryptic and surreptitious fashion along the left margin of the letter.

If one extracts just the first letter of each line, you would spell out a rather juvenile insult that read "F*ck You." A copy of the letter is reproduced below with the offending letters highlighted in yellow.



Schwarzenegger typically attaches a message to bills he signs or vetoes telling assemblymen why he took the action. It is assumed that Arnold's profane missive is in response to Ammiano's request that the Governator "kiss my gay ass" during a local Democratic Party fundraiser earlier this month in San Francisco.

Schwarzenegger, who is a Republican, was invited to the normally Democrat only event by former San Francisco mayor and Assembly speaker Willie Brown, also a Democrat.

Arnold gave a brief speech at the event, during which Ammiano and other Dems booed and heckled him, shouting "You lie." After Schwarzenegger left, Ammiano gave a speech criticizing Schwarzenegger for a wide variety of real or imagined offenses.

Aaron McLear, a spokesperson for Schwarzenegger explained to reporters' queries about the letter: "My goodness. What a coincidence. I suppose when you do so many vetoes, something like this is bound to happen."

Ammiano's spokesperson, Quintin Mecke's response was that the assemblyman wants to move on. "We will call it even and start with a clean slate with the governor from here on out."

Sarah Palin Announces New Twitter Site, Less PC Tweets


Sarah Palin announced on her State of Alaska Twitter site on late Thursday that she intends to continue to update her fans on a new personal Twitter site that will be launched on July 26th. Plus she promises that her tweets (comments) will be less politically correct.

The natural question one wants to ask is why would she continue to update her fans if she is through with public life? Someone who intends to run for President in 2012, on the other hand, would certainly want to keep her fans informed by continuing to tweet them updates of her activities.

The exact message the governor tweeted was, "I'll stay in touch w/whomever wants via personal twtr site;launch July 26;in meantime it's pleasure to update interested folks on State biz!"

Governor Palin sent her tweet to her fans about 10:30 PM PDT Thursday night.

Palin also said in another tweet at around the same time, "elected is replaceable;Ak WILL progress! + side benefit=10 dys til less politically correct twitters fly frm my fingertps outside State site."

That tweet indicates that she may be more frank when leveling her opinions and comments in the future.

Sarah Palin on Larry King - Video

Sarah Palin was interviewed on the Larry King Show on Wednesday, 11/12/2008. Larry asked some pointed questions, such as: "Should you have not done the Katie Couric Interview?"

Sarah said she felt that the Couric interview did not hurt the Republican campaign.

King asked her if those knocking her from inside the McCain camp hurt her. She responded no, she does not know any individuals from the McCain camp who were knocking her. She said unknown individuals could be just about anyone, so there is no sense in even responding to those criticisms.

King asked did you want to make a concession speech? Sarah responded that she would have loved to do so and that her speech would have been to praise John McCain, American hero.

Sarah said the $150,000 worth of clothes ruckus was ridiculous. She said she did not keep the clothes, and they were returned to the Republican campaign.

Do you pledge to the people that you will serve out your term? asked Larry. She responded that she will do whatever the people of Alaska want her to do. If they want her to call an audible to serve in another capacity, then so be it.
